Start your day at Toccoa Falls, a beautiful 186-foot waterfall located on the campus of Toccoa Falls College. Take a leisurely hike on the nature trail that leads to the falls and enjoy the stunning scenery. There are picnic areas available, so pack a lunch and enjoy a family picnic amidst the natural beauty.
Spend the morning at the Currahee Military Museum, a museum dedicated to the history of the 506th Parachute Infantry Regiment, made famous by the HBO series "Band of Brothers." Learn about their training and experiences during World War II, and see artifacts such as weapons, uniforms, and documents. There is also an outdoor area with memorials and a Sherman tank.
